Boland road race league starts
2011-01-20
THE first in a series of ten road races in the 2010 Boland Road Running League Season will start on 5 February with the 2011 Prison to Prison Road Race (10 and 21 km) at the premises of the Brandvlei Correctional Services. This race will also be the first in a series of three races where athletes can qualify for the Boland team to the 2011 SA 10km Championships in May 2011. Times athletes must run to qualify for the Boland team to the 2011 SA 10km championship are junior men (30:40), men (29:50), junior women (35:50) and women (34:50). This race will be followed by the SA Marathon Championship (13 February), the Swartland 10 and 21km (5 March), the Rainbow 10km (Boland 10km Champs) on 12 March, the SAD 21km (2 May), the De Doorns 10 and 21km (21 May), the SA 10km Champs (22 May), the Robertson 10 and 21km (Boland half-marathon championship) on 4 June, the SA half-marathon championship (2 Jul), the Voorsieners 10 and 21km (16 July), the Paarlberg 10 and 21km (13 August), the Riebeek Kasteel 10 and 21km (3 September), the Michell’s Pass 10 and 21km (15 October), the Dwarsrivier 10 and 21km (5 November) and the Winelands 42km Boland Marathon Champion-ship (19 November).
